In the men’s 50m rifle three positions final, Alexis Exequiel Eberhardt of Argentina claimed gold with a 16-8 win over Leonardo Vagner Do Nascimento Moreira of Brazil. In shooting finals, Brazil claimed a one-two in the men’s 25 metres rapid fire pistol with Emerson Duarte taking gold with 22 points, from Felipe Almeida Wu, in silver on 21. Peru’s Roberto Yata Galaretta Villar won the men’s under-90kg category, overcoming Mariano Coto Bersier of Argentina.Ĭelinda Jamileth Corozo Ramirez of Ecuador won the women’s under-70kg category, overcoming Millena Ribeiro Da Silva of Brazil.įinally, in the women’s under-78kg category, Elvismar Nicanor Rodriguez Ruiz of Venezuela, defeated Beatriz Furtado Petri De Freitas of Brazil. The men’s under-81kg category was won by Agustin Nicolas Gil of Argentina, who defeated Jorge Daniel Perez Alvarez of Chile. The men’s over +100kg was won by Ecuador’s Freddy Miguel Figueroa Ortiz, who beat Luis Mauricio Amezquita Urqueola of Venezuela. The women’s over +78kg category was won by Giovanni Melo Dos Santos of Brazil, who triumphed against Amarantha Aurora Urdaneta Duarte of Venezuela. In the men’s under-100 kilograms category Brazil’s Gabriel Dezani Arevalo overcame Antonio Jose Rodriguez Rengel of Venezuela. Brazil won two gold medals in the judo competition at the South American Games in Asunción, Paraguay.
